I don't think any manufacturer is really out to lure top FPO players on to their teams at this point. The 3-4 most significant sponsor changes in the FPO division over the last few years have struck me more as the women looking to move on from their old sponsor rather than being lured away by a Godfather offer (i.e. "an offer she can't refuse"). Val left Innova before she had anything new locked up. Same for Elaine and Discraft. Paige wasn't really shopping herself, she left Prodigy to go to DD because that's where she wanted to be regardless of what they offered (but they do take very good care of her). Maybe Hokom to MVP was a lure deal, but it's not like Legacy was in a position to match even a modest offer from someone else.
